Alek Thomas, Jake McCarthy Could be Traded

Arizona Diamondbacks All-Star second baseman Ketel Marte has been rumored as a trade candidate this offseason, but The Arizona Republic's Nick Piecoro thinks it's more likely that the team's trade options involve outfielders Alek Thomas and Jake McCarthy, who are both arbitration-eligible. If the D-backs trade one of Thomas or McCarthy away, they have options to replace them with the likes of Jorge Barrosa, Tim Tawa, Blaze Alexander, and potentially even Jordan Lawlar. For fantasy baseball purposes, McCarthy is the more attractive player, although he played in only 67 games in 2025 and hit .204 (42-for-206) with four home runs, 20 RBI, 18 runs scored, and six stolen bases in his fifth year in the league. If McCarthy were ever to win a full-time job in Arizona or elsewhere, though, his speed would make him interesting in fantasy. McCarthy had three straight 20-steal seasons from 2022-24.

Alek Thomas Goes on Bereavement List

The Arizona Diamondbacks announced on Friday that they placed outfielder Alek Thomas on the bereavement list and recalled outfielder Jorge Barrosa from Triple-A Reno in a corresponding move. Thomas will most likely miss the entire weekend series in Pittsburgh at PNC Park against the Pirates. Jake McCarthy is making the start in center field and will hit seventh in Friday's series opener against Pirates right-hander Mike Burrows. The 25-year-old Thomas is most useful for his range and glove on defense in center field. In his fourth year with the D-backs, he's hit a middling .246/.294/.366 with a career-best .660 OPS, five home runs, 26 RBI, 33 runs scored and five stolen bases in 292 trips to the plate over 90 games. Although McCarthy has gone just 13-for-93 (.140) on the year, he has more offensive upside in fantasy than Thomas.

Alek Thomas Goes Yard and Swipes a Bag

Arizona Diamondbacks speedy outfielder Alek Thomas went 3-for-3 with a solo home run, a walk, a stolen base, and four total runs scored in Tuesday's 10-3 win over the Mariners. It was quite the evening for Thomas, as he was active on the basepaths and blasted his third home run of the season. The home run came in the eighth inning with the Diamondbacks already up 9-3 in the contest. Thomas is enjoying a nice 2025 campaign, slashing .273/.315/.395 with 21 runs scored, 19 RBI, and four stolen bases. He has taken off in June, slashing .370/.393/.593. He seems to have an everyday role with the Diamondbacks, perhaps occasionally sitting against a left-handed pitcher, but the 25-year-old provides a lot of speed and good defense, making him an interesting player if he can continue to stay hot and get the opportunities. For now, he can remain on the waiver wire in most formats.

Alek Thomas Making The Start Over Jake McCarthy On Friday

Arizona Diamondbacks outfielder Alex Thomas will make the start in center field over Jake McCarthy on Friday in the second game of the season against the visiting Chicago Cubs and right-hander Jameson Taillon at Chase Field. Thomas will bat seventh in the lineup. Thomas comes into 2025 looking to bounce back after a very disappointing 2024 campaign in which he played in only 39 games at the big-league level due to injuries and poor performance. In 103 plate appearances for Arizona, the 24-year-old left-handed hitter went just 18-for-95 (.189) with three home runs, 17 RBI and four stolen bases. Defense has been his calling card so far early in his career, but with a likely platoon role in Arizona's outfield this year, it's hard to get excited about him as anything more than outfield depth in NL-only leagues. Thomas is hitless in only two career at-bats against Taillon.

Alek Thomas Back From Minor-League Injured List

Arizona Diamondbacks outfielder Alek Thomas (oblique) was reinstated from the seven-day minor-league injured list at Triple-A Reno on Tuesday. In his return to the field with the Aces on Tuesday, Thomas went 2-for-4 with a double and two runs scored. The 24-year-old has been out of action for the past month with a strained right oblique but is working his way back and could be able to rejoin the big-league roster before the end of the regular season at the end of September. If Thomas does rejoin the D-backs and they make the postseason, he'll likely be a bench player and potential late-game replacement for his defense in center field. Thomas has played in a career-low 37 games in Arizona in 2024 in his third year in the majors and has hit just .191 (18-for-94) with three homers, 17 RBI and four steals. Jake McCarthy has essentially taken over for Thomas at the big-league level.

Alek Thomas Sent To Triple-A

The Arizona Diamondbacks optioned outfielder Alek Thomas to Triple-A Reno following Tuesday night's game against the Colorado Rockies and recalled rookie infielder Blaze Alexander from Reno in a corresponding move on Wednesday. Thomas has missed a big chunk of this season due to injury and wasn't swinging the bat well enough upon his return to warrant a roster spot at the big-league level, despite his excellent glove work. The 24-year-old left-handed hitter has batted just .191 (18-for-94) this year with three home runs, 17 RBI and four stolen bases in 37 games played in his third year in Arizona. Thomas' demotion is good news for Jake McCarthy, who has become a lineup regular for the Snakes in a breakout year. Alexander, meanwhile could see some starts at second base, including on Wednesday, with Ketel Marte nursing a low-grade ankle sprain.

Alek Thomas On The Bench Saturday

Arizona Diamondbacks outfielder Alek Thomas is not in the starting lineup for Saturday's contest against the hosting Pittsburgh Pirates. The 24-year-old singled, walked, and drove in two runs during Friday's 9-8 win but will give way to Jake McCarthy for Saturday's contest. It has been another difficult season at the plate for Thomas as he has not only dealt with a hamstring injury but has also struggled at the plate. He is hitting just .208 with three homers, three stolen bases, and a .672 OPS across 83 trips to the plate. However, his .347 xwOBA is well beyond his .288 wOBA at the moment. While he hasn't provided much to fantasy managers this season, there is likely some positive regression to be had down the stretch.
